This is the final call for registration for:

British Women Documentary Film-makers 1930 - 1955
5 April 2019
A symposium at the London School of Economics

Further details and registration link:

https://www.jillcraigiefilmpioneer.org/news-events/

This is the first event organized as part of the project Jill Craigie: Film Pioneer, supported by the Arts and Humanities Research Council.
